When a pilot recovers from a spin, it is essential to follow specific procedures to regain control of the aircraft safely. The correct recovery actions typically are:

  1. Reducing throttle to idle to reduce lift and stop feeding the spin.
  2. Applying full opposite rudder to counteract the spin.
  3. Forward pressure on the control column to break the stall.
  4. Waiting until the rotation stops before doing anything else.
  5. Once the rotation has ceased, gradually pulling out of the dive and adding power as necessary.
